Abstract

The thermodynamic calculation of oxygen solubility and ionic standing in solutions of cerium(III) phosphate acids allowed us to estimate the ionic composition of solutions and describe the course of crystallization and dilution processes of SePO4-0.5H2O, as well as to determine the dependence of oxygen solubility on temperature and concentration of solutions.
